Semen Collection in Medical Contexts

In medical settings, semen collection serves several purposes. Clinicians use it to assess semen quality, including volume, sperm count, motility, and morphology, which are essential for diagnosing male infertility. Donor programmes rely on semen collection to ensure suitable fertility material for recipients while maintaining safety and privacy. Researchers may collect semen for studies on reproductive biology, contraception, or new fertility therapies. Across these contexts, semen collection is conducted with strict protocols to protect patient privacy, sample integrity, and the safety of all parties involved.

Key Terms and What They Mean

Understanding the vocabulary around semen collection helps you feel prepared. Some commonly used terms include:

  • Semen – the fluid released during ejaculation, which contains sperm and other fluids from the reproductive tract.
  • Sperm – the male reproductive cells responsible for fertilising an egg.
  • Ejaculate – the semen that is expelled during orgasm.
  • Semen analysis – a laboratory assessment of semen quality, including volume, concentration, motility, and morphology.
  • Collection container – a sterile or approved vessel provided by the clinic for semen collection.
  • Abstinence period – the recommended period of avoiding ejaculation before collection to optimise semen quality.

Preparing for Semen Collection

Preparation is the unseen element that can significantly influence semen collection results. Here are practical steps to help you prepare, whether you are collecting at home or in a clinic.

Abstinence and Timing

Clinicians typically recommend an abstinence period before semen collection. A common window is two to five days since last ejaculation. Too frequent ejaculation can reduce sperm concentration, while too long a gap may not reflect your current fertility status. If a clinic provides specific instructions, follow them closely, as guidelines can vary depending on the purpose of the semen collection and the testing method used.

Hygiene and Contamination Prevention

Cleanliness is essential for accurate results. Wash your hands thoroughly before handling the collection container. Do not apply lubricants or oils to the genital area unless they are explicitly approved by the clinic, as many substances can interfere with semen analysis. If you use a at-home collection container, it should be sterile and provided by the clinic or laboratory. Contamination with urine, vaginal fluids, or dirt can affect the sample’s composition and the interpretation of results.

Lifestyle and Substances

Alcohol, tobacco, and recreational drugs can influence semen quality. If possible, maintain a healthy lifestyle in the days leading up to collection. Caffeine intake and certain medications can also impact results, so discuss any regular medicines with your clinician. In some cases, temporary changes to your routine may be advised to optimise the sample.

At-Home vs Clinic Semen Collection

There are practical differences between at-home and clinic-based semen collection. With at-home collection, you will usually receive a collection kit including a sterile container and clear instructions on how to handle, label, and transport the sample. The sample often needs to reach the laboratory within a defined time frame—typically within an hour of collection—to ensure sample integrity. In-clinic collection occurs under direct supervision, which can be reassuring for some individuals and may streamline the process of immediate analysis.

Step-by-Step: How to Perform Semen Collection

  1. Prepare the space and container – Gather the sterile collection container and, if required, a discreet label. Ensure you are in a private, comfortable setting, free from interruptions.
  2. Wash and dry your hands – Cleanliness reduces the risk of sample contamination. Dry hands to avoid diluting the sample.
  3. Avoid lubricants unless approved – If lubrication is necessary, confirm that it is semen-analysis friendly. Most clinics discourage unapproved lubricants.
  4. Engage in ejaculation – The sample is typically obtained through masturbation. Take your time and aim for a calm, relaxed experience. If you have difficulty, speak with a clinician about alternatives.
  5. Secure the sample promptly – After ejaculation, seal the container securely. Submit the sample as directed by your clinic or courier service.
  6. Label and transport – Clearly label the container with your initials, date, and time of collection. If transporting, keep the sample at body temperature and avoid exposure to excessive heat or cold.
  7. Follow-up instructions – Some clinics require a brief health questionnaire or additional sample for verification. Adhere to any post-collection guidance provided by the healthcare team.

If you are collecting at home, maintain the sample in a warm location close to body temperature until delivery. Avoid contact with urine or foreign substances, as contamination can affect the sample’s quality. If you have doubts during the collection, contact the clinic for advice rather than proceeding with uncertain steps.

Handling and Transport of Semen Samples

Once collected, semen samples must be handled with care to preserve their integrity. The most common considerations include:

  • Temperature – Keep the sample at a stable, moderate temperature. Do not expose it to direct sunlight or extreme heat. In transit, many clinics recommend maintaining body temperature by keeping the sample close to the body or in a specialised transport pouch.
  • Timing – Transit time matters. Deliver or ship the sample within the window specified by the laboratory, usually within an hour of collection, to ensure accurate analysis.
  • Documentation – Include all required labels and forms. Accurate identifiers help prevent mix-ups in the lab.

Upon receipt, laboratory staff will process the semen collection for analysis. They may perform a semen analysis to determine volume, sperm concentration, motility, and morphology. Depending on the purpose, the sample may undergo additional procedures, such as preparing sperm for assisted reproduction or storing it for later use.

Common Issues and Troubleshooting

Even with careful preparation, you may encounter questions or issues with semen collection. Here are common concerns and practical guidance:

  • Inability to ejaculate – If you have difficulty with ejaculation, discuss options with your clinician. In some cases, alternative retrieval methods may be considered, especially if there are medical or psychological barriers.
  • Contamination – Urine contamination or the use of unapproved lubricants can alter results. If contamination is suspected, inform the laboratory so they can interpret results appropriately or request another sample if permitted.
  • Sample volume or quality concerns – If the initial sample does not meet expected criteria, your clinician may advise withholding quick conclusions and may request a repeat sample to confirm results.
  • Storage and shipping challenges – Ensure you follow the laboratory’s instructions for shipping and storage. Improper handling can compromise the sample’s viability.

Open communication with the clinic or laboratory is key. They can explain what the results mean, how to prepare for a repeat sample if required, and any steps to improve outcomes in future collections.

Semen Collection and Fertility Testing

In fertility testing, semen collection plays a crucial role in diagnosing male factor infertility. The semen analysis evaluates several parameters:

  • Volume of semen per ejaculation
  • Sperm concentration (sperm per millilitre)
  • Total sperm count (sperm per ejaculate)
  • Motility (the ability of sperm to move efficiently)
  • Morphology (shape and structure of sperm)
  • Other indicators, such as vitality and liquefaction time

Understanding these results helps clinicians determine potential causes of infertility and decide on appropriate treatment options. In some cases, the results lead to lifestyle recommendations or targeted fertility treatments, such as intrauterine insemination (IUI) or in vitro fertilisation (IVF). Ethical and Legal Considerations in Semen Collection

Ethical and legal aspects underpin semen collection, particularly in donor programmes and research. Key considerations include:

  • Consent and privacy: Donors consent to the use of their semen in accordance with regulatory frameworks, with clear limitations on how samples may be used and stored.
  • Storage and duration: Semen samples may be stored for a defined period with the option to extend storage under strict governance. Donors are informed about how long samples will be kept and when they may be discarded.
  • Usage rights: Recipients and clinics follow guidelines on who may access semen samples and for what purposes, ensuring that patient and donor rights are protected.
  • Safety and screening: Donor semen undergoes screening for infections and other conditions to safeguard recipients and ensure high-quality material.

Alternatives and Special Situations in Semen Collection

While most semen collection approaches are straightforward, certain situations require alternatives or adaptations. For example, some individuals may have medical conditions that affect ejaculation. In such cases, clinicians may consider:

  • Vibratory stimulation or electroejaculation in specific circumstances, often under medical supervision.
  • Surgical retrieval options, such as testicular or epididymal sperm extraction, when ejaculation is not possible or when the semen sample cannot be obtained through standard means. These methods are typically used within fertility clinics in coordination with a physician.

It’s important to discuss all available options with your clinician. They can explain the pros, cons, and potential outcomes relevant to your health and fertility goals.

Frequently Asked Questions about Semen Collection

Below are common questions people have about semen collection, answered in plain terms:

  • How long should I abstain before semen collection? Most guidelines suggest two to five days, but follow your clinic’s specific instruction.
  • Can I use a home collection kit? Yes, many clinics provide home collection kits, with strict instructions for transport to the lab within the required timeframe.
  • What if my sample is rejected by the lab? The lab may request a repeat sample to confirm results or to ensure accuracy. Communicate with the clinic to schedule a follow-up collection.
  • Is semen collection painful? Most people experience little to no discomfort. If you feel pain or unusual symptoms, inform your clinician so they can assess and address any concerns.
  • What happens after the semen analysis? The results guide discussions about fertility options, donor programmes, or research participation. Your clinician will explain the implications and the next steps.
